Notre Dame, CCS Win In District Soccer Semifinals

  • Saturday, October 7, 2017

The Notre Dame Lady Irish and CCS Lady Chargers both won Division II District soccer semifinals on Saturday.  Notre Dame beat Silverdale 8-0 and CCS beat Grace 5-0.   Notre Dame and CCS will play in the district championship on Tuesday at CCS.

In Notre Dame's win, Maddie Engle had two goals.  Lauren Bird, Savannah Tucker, Brooke Higgins, Lauren Masterson, Sarah Moore and Cassidy Barta all had one goal.  

Sarah Moore had two assists.  Cassidy Barta, Anna Behlau and Lauren Masterson each had one assist.  Notre Dame out shot Silverdale 31-2.  Lauren Teal had two saves for Notre Dame.
